Full Description
On Oxygen: From Air to Tissues, the latest release in the Fundamentals of Physiology series, provides a fundamental overview of the entire oxygen pathway, sharing key mechanistic insights into the alternating conductive and diffusive steps of O2 transport. The book describes specific aspects along each stage of the oxygen route through the body, from the transfer of air to the alveoli, through the lungs, to the ultimate fate of O2 in the mitochondria. Additionally, the effect of specific disease states, aging, and developmental aspects are considered.
This book, published in association with the International Union of Physiological Sciences, acts is a valuable introduction to the full biological journey of oxygen, and is a beneficial guide for students and researchers in physiology, sport science, pulmonology, and related fields.
